EmploymentTeacher salaries for the 2012-2013 school year for 9 months of service range from $34,680 to $52,780: depending upon training and experience. Benefits include teacher retirement, employee health insurance, and professional development incentives. Substitute Teaching Positions New Substitute Teachers: You will need to apply with DESE before submitting your application to Neosho R-5 Schools. Go to www.dese.mo.gov/divteachqual/teachcert/ to begin your application process. Please refer to the "Help Guide to Certification System" on this page, if you have any questions. Once you have been cleared by the State, you may fill out the following application. Please email (haystammie@neosho.k12.mo.us) or return packet to our offices at 418 Fairground Road, Neosho, MO 64850. Substitute Teacher Application Returning Substitute Teachers: You will need to check the DESE website ( www.dese.mo.gov/divteachqual/teachcert/ )to see if you are verified to sub for the following year. Go into the licensure system to your profile to verify that you have a certificate. Please refer to the "Help Guide to Certification System" if you have any questions. If you did NOT work at least one full day in the district the previous year, DESE requires you to re-apply as a substitute teacher. Substitute certificates will NO LONGER be mailed. Your certificate may be viewed and printed on the DESE website.
